In a certain code, 256 means red colour chalk, 589 means green colour flower, and 245 means white colour chalk. What digit in that code does mean white?
In the first and second statements, the common digit is 5 and the common word is colour. So, 5 means colour. In the first and third statements, the common code digit is 2 and the common word is chalk. So, 2 means chalk. Thus, is third and above statements 4 means white.
